本文目录导读:
探索数学中的基本构建块
在数学的世界里,质数是一个独特而引人入胜的概念,它们不仅是数学理论的基础,还在密码学、计算机科学等领域发挥着重要作用,质数究竟是什么呢?本文将带您一起探索质数的奥秘,揭示其在数学和现实世界中的意义。
质数的定义与性质
质数,又称素数,是指在大于1的自然数中,除了1和该数自身外,无法被其他自然数整除的数,换句话说,质数只有两个正因数:1和它本身,2、3、5、7、11等都是质数,而像4、6、8、9等数,除了1和本身外,还能被其他数整除,因此它们不是质数。
质数具有以下几个重要性质:
1、质数有无限多个,这一结论由古希腊数学家欧几里得在《几何原本》中给出证明。
2、除了2以外,所有的质数都是奇数,这是因为偶数都可以被2整除,而质数只有两个正因数,所以除了2以外,其他质数都必须是奇数。
3、任意大于1的自然数都可以表示为若干个质数的乘积,这一结论被称为质因数分解定理,是数学中的一个基本定理。
质数的历史与发现
质数的概念源远流长,早在古希腊时期,数学家们就开始研究质数,毕达哥拉斯学派认为,数是万物的本原,而质数则是数的基本单位,他们发现,许多自然现象和规律都与质数有关,黄金分割比例(约为1.618)就是一个无理数,但其连分数表示中的分母都是质数。
随着数学的发展,质数的研究逐渐深入,欧拉、高斯等数学家在质数领域取得了重要成果,欧拉提出了著名的欧拉定理,即对于任意正整数a和n(n>1),如果a和n互质,则a的φ(n)次方模n同余于1((n)表示小于n且与n互质的正整数的个数),高斯则提出了质数定理的近似公式,即当x很大时,小于x的质数个数大约等于x/ln(x)。
质数的应用与意义
质数在数学和现实世界中具有广泛的应用和重要意义,以下是一些典型的例子:
1、密码学:质数在密码学中发挥着关键作用,许多加密算法都依赖于质数的性质来实现安全的数据传输和存储,RSA加密算法就是基于质因数分解的困难性来确保信息的安全。
2、计算机科学:在计算机科学中,质数被用于生成随机数、检测循环冗余等,质数还在算法分析和优化中发挥着重要作用。
3、物理学:在物理学中,质数也具有一定的应用价值,在量子力学中,质数被用于描述粒子的能级和跃迁,质数还与一些物理现象和规律有关,如费马小定理和欧拉定理在量子力学中的应用。
4、经济学:在经济学中,质数也被用于分析市场结构和竞争策略,一些经济学家利用质数理论来研究寡头市场的均衡问题。
质数的挑战与未来
尽管质数在数学和现实世界中具有广泛的应用和重要意义,但关于质数的研究仍面临着许多挑战,以下是一些典型的挑战和未来的研究方向:
1、质数分布规律:尽管我们已经知道质数有无限多个,但关于质数的分布规律仍然是一个未解之谜,孪生质数(相差2的质数对)是否存在无穷多对?这是一个著名的未解问题,未来的研究可以进一步探索质数的分布规律和性质。
2、质因数分解算法:质因数分解是数学中的一个基本问题,但现有的算法在处理大数时效率较低,开发更高效的质因数分解算法是一个重要的研究方向,这将有助于推动密码学、计算机科学等领域的发展。
3、质数与数学其他分支的联系:质数与数学的其他分支有着密切的联系,代数数论、解析数论等领域都涉及到质数的研究,未来的研究可以进一步探索质数与数学其他分支的联系和交叉点,以推动数学学科的发展。
质数是数学中的一个独特而引人入胜的概念,它们不仅是数学理论的基础,还在密码学、计算机科学等领域发挥着重要作用,通过探索质数的奥秘和性质,我们可以更好地理解数学和现实世界之间的联系,质数的研究也面临着许多挑战和未来的发展方向,让我们期待未来在质数领域取得更多的突破和进展!
发表评论